Machinist

Saronic Technologies is seeking a Machinist to support vessel production, prototyping, manufacturing, and sustainment activities across our autonomous vessel programs. This role is responsible for producing precision components, tooling, fixtures, and production hardware supporting vessel construction, integration, testing, and operations. The Machinist will work closely with engineering, manufacturing, production, and commissioning teams to rapidly fabricate and modify components in support of a fast-paced shipyard and manufacturing environment.

The ideal candidate is highly skilled in manual and CNC machining operations, enjoys solving manufacturing challenges, and thrives in an environment where speed, quality, and innovation are critical to mission success.

Responsibilities
  • Set up and operate manual and CNC machine tools including mills, lathes, drill presses, and saws
  • Manufacture precision components, fixtures, tooling, and production hardware from engineering drawings and CAD models
  • Support prototype development, production improvements, and rapid design iterations
  • Perform machining operations on aluminum, stainless steel, composites, plastics, and other materials used in vessel construction
  • Inspect completed components using precision measurement equipment to verify dimensional accuracy and quality requirements
  • Assist engineers with manufacturability reviews and fabrication planning
  • Support vessel integration, commissioning, and field operations through rapid fabrication and repair activities
  • Maintain machine tooling, work holding equipment, and shop organization
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ives focused on manufacturing efficiency, quality, and throughput
  • Adhere to all safety, quality, and operational procedures
Qualifications
  • High school diploma, GED, technical school certification, or equivalent experience
  • 3+ years of machining experience in manufacturing, aerospace, defense, maritime, or industrial environments
  • Experience operating manual mills, lathes, and CNC equipment
  • Ability to read engineering drawings, GD&T callouts, and technical documentation
  • Proficiency with precision measurement tools including calipers, micrometers, indicators, and gauges
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and problem-solving skills
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ities
  • Comfortable working in manufacturing and shipyard environments
  • Experience with CAD/CAM software
  • Familiarity with aluminum vessel construction and marine systems
  • Experience supporting defense, robotics, aerospace, or autonomous systems programs
  • Welding, fabrication, or assembly experience
  • Technical certifications in machining or manufacturing technologies
